MEDIA RELEASE AsiaSat Reports 2017 Annual Results Hong Kong, 23 March 2018 - Asia Satellite Telecommunications Holdings Limited (‘AsiaSat’ – SEHK: 1135), Asia’s leading satellite operator, today announced financial results for the full- year ended 31 December 2017. Financial Highlights: 2017 revenue returned to an upward trend with an increase of 6% to HK$1,354 million from HK$1,272 million in 2016, supported by the lease of the full Ku-band payload of AsiaSat 8 during the year, on-going migration from Standard Definition to High Definition broadcasting and increased demand for data services 2017 profit attributable to owners was HK$397 million (2016: HK$430 million). On a like-for- like basis, after excluding a reversal of tax provision of HK$55 million in 2016, 2017 profit recorded an increase of 6%, HK$22 million compared to 2016 Proposed final dividend of HK$0.20 per share (2016: HK$0.20 per share). Together with the interim dividend of HK$0.18 per share (2016: Nil), the total dividend for the year 2017 is HK$0.38 per share (2016: HK$0.20 per share ) Operational Highlights: AsiaSat enters its 30th year in 2018 with an expanded and upgraded satellite fleet, including the new AsiaSat 9 which became fully operational in November 2017, bringing improved performance to customers and additional capacity to grow company business A lease for the full payload of AsiaSat 4 was secured following successful migration of customers from AsiaSat 4 to AsiaSat 9, the full revenue impact of which will be seen in 2018 Overall payload utilisation -

MEDIA RELEASE AsiaSat distributes live coverage of 2018 Asian Games Hong Kong, 15 August 2018 – Asia Satellite Telecommunications Company Limited (AsiaSat – SEHK: 1135) supports live coverage of the 2018 Asian Games with AsiaSat 5. The 18th Asian Games, co-hosted by the cities of Jakarta and Palembang of Indonesia, includes 40 sports, to be contested by over 11,000 athletes from 45 participating countries and regions. Live HD coverage of the Games from the opening ceremony on 18 August to the closing on 2 September will be telecast across AsiaSat 5’s C-band footprint for viewers to enjoy real-time on TVs, online and mobile devices. Ina Lui, Senior Vice President, Commercial, Business Development and Strategy of AsiaSat said, “Following a sports packed summer delivering the World Cup, LPGA tour, BWF World Championship and more, we are thrilled to continue the action with coverage of the upcoming 2018 Asian Games for our Asia-Pacific viewers. An historic event for AsiaSat, from first broadcasting the 1990 Asian Games in Beijing on AsiaSat 1, we are pleased to again deliver the pinnacle event for Asian athletes.” New events will feature for the first time this year, as ‘e-sports’ and ‘canoe polo’ are introduced as demonstration sports to the Games. 16 AsiaSat Annual Report 2006 Operations Review Market Review The effects of the growing strength in some Asian economies have still not worked their way through to the satellite industry. This is caused, partly, by the fact that new demand is being absorbed by the existing oversupply that, concurrently, is being increased by new launches. This phenomenon, generally, continues to impact rates negatively and is keeping the market highly competitive. A further factor is that the satellite sector typically lags behind others in responding to overall shifts in the economy, so it is again unlikely in the near future that AsiaSat will see significant improvements in demand for transponder capacity in most Asian markets. As the Chairman has reported, however, there are emerging positive trends that give us good reason to remain optimistic for the longer term. First, much of the new capacity that has been launched or is scheduled to be launched in the near future is replacing existing satellites or is dedicated to specific government supported domestic initiatives. And second, new applications will drive further demand for satellite capacity, as will deregulation, of which there are also positive signs as some governments have indicated that they are prepared to open up their domestic markets to new satellite delivery services. NEW SATELLITE CAPACITY In 2006, nine new satellites that cover portions of Asia were launched, but two suffered total loss at launch. After the retirement or relocation of five others, the seven successful new satellites brought the total number covering the region to 77 (2005: 75), a net increase of two.
